Thank you, Madam Chair. There are a large number of services that have become available over the years that are not currently covered under our insured services. Our insured services coverage is fairly dated and it hasn’t really had a very comprehensive review in some time, which is one of the reasons why we’ve created the chief clinical advisor position to help us actually do this analysis to make sure that the types of things that are covered under insured services are really keeping with the times, and the fact that the health system does change and evolve and new programs and services come in.
We’ve had the chief clinical advisor on for a while. One of his primary tasks is to provide clinic guidance around clinical practice guidelines but also to provide advice and guidance on what we have and currently cover under insured services.
One of the things we are looking at, as well as many others, is bariatric surgery. It’s going to take a bit of time to make sure that we’re doing the comprehensive analysis on that and then we bring those forward for discussion.
At this point in time, there is no discussion about including naturopathic doctors under insured services.
